Abstract
Using Doppler-reduced laser induced fluorescence spectroscopy in an atomic beam, the hyperfine structure of 22 levels of the configuration 4f 135d6s6p in neutral ytterbium has been investigated for the two odd isotopes 171 Yb and 171 Yb. The experimental results have been used in a study of the hyperfine structure in regard to a determination of the one-electron parameters for the magnetic dipole and the electric quadrupole hyperfine coupling of the isotope 173 Yb in part II of this work.
